#2 Stop Workout Soreness in Its Tracks
If you enjoy a hard workout, chances are you always feel sore the following day. The stiffness occurs due to the breakdown of muscle tissues, and the onset of inflammation.
Turmeric helps to inhibit the inflammatory response, reducing muscle stiffness the day after training.
#3 Reduce the Symptoms of Inflammatory Disease
If you're dealing with rheumatoid arthritis or other auto-immune disorders, consuming a turmeric shot every morning can help your body deal with the effects of inflammatory disease.
The curcumin in turmeric helps to neutralize inflammatory cytokines, preventing them from turning on the genes that cause the inflammatory response.

It Might Conflict with Medications
If you're using any medication, turmeric might amplify or neutralize the effects of the medicine. Speak to your doctor for advice before introducing turmeric shots to your breakfast.
